NAZ2329, the first cell-permeable inhibitor of R5 subfamily of receptor-type protein tyrosine phosphatases (RPTPs), allosterically and preferentially inhibits PTPRZ (IC50=7.5 µM for hPTPRZ1) and PTPRG (IC50=4.8 µM for hPTPRG) over other PTPs. NAZ2329 binds to the active D1 domain and more potently inhibits PTPRZ-D1 fragment (IC50 of 1.1 µM) than the whole intracellular (D1 + D2) fragment (IC50 of 7.5 µM). NAZ2329 can effectively inhibit tumor growth of the glioblastoma cells and suppress stem cell-like properties[1].

NAZ2329 (0-25 µM; 48 hours) dose-dependently inhibits cell proliferation and migration in all cell lines (rat glioblastoma cells bearing C6 clone and human U251 glioblastoma cells) [1].NAZ2329 (25 µM; 0-90 min) obviously promotes the phosphorylation level of paxillin at Tyr-118 site, leading to inhibition for PTPR substrate[1]. Cell Proliferation Assay[1] Cell Line: Rat glioblastoma cells bearing C6 clone, human U251 glioblastoma cells

NAZ2329 (22.5 mg/kg; intraperitoneal injection; twice per week; 40 days) alone has a moderate inhibitory effect. However, the combination of Temozolomide and NAZ2329 exerts a significantly increased inhibition of tumor growth compared with the control group, the NAZ2329 monotherapy group and the Temozolomide monotherapy group[1]. Animal Model: Female BALB/c- nu/nu mice aged 4 week-old bearing parental or Ptprz-knockdown C6 cells[1]

[1]. Akihiro Fujikawa, et al. Targeting PTPRZ inhibits stem cell-like properties and tumorigenicity in glioblastoma cells. Sci Rep. 2017 Jul 17;7(1):5609.
